FUJIKINA Warsaw 2026 Announced for June 12-13 at Dom Towarowy Bracia Jabłkowscy
Fujifilm has officially announced FUJIKINA Warsaw 2026, which will take place on June 12-13, 2026, at Dom Towarowy Bracia Jabłkowscy in Warsaw, Poland.
FUJIKINA is Fujifilm’s international photography festival series, and Warsaw joins past stops such as Tokyo, New York, Berlin, Prague, Milan, and Barcelona. The event is designed for a broad audience of photographers, from working professionals and semi-professionals to passionate enthusiasts who want to build their skills, test gear, and connect with other creators.
The program will include lectures, presentations, masterclass workshops, exhibitions, portfolio reviews, photo walks, a Touch & Try area, free equipment loans, and on-site service support. Fujifilm says attendees will be able to explore both the FUJIFILM X and GFX systems while also taking part in hands-on experiences and live sessions throughout the festival.
According to the official event page, the festival will run from 9:30 AM to 6:30 PM on both days. Standard admission is listed at 39 PLN for a one-day ticket or 59 PLN for a two-day pass, while Masterclass workshops are sold separately and are currently listed from 590 PLN.
Event Details
- Event: FUJIKINA Warsaw 2026
- Dates: June 12-13, 2026
- Hours: 9:30 AM – 6:30 PM
- Venue: Dom Towarowy Bracia Jabłkowscy
- Address: Bracka 25, 00-021 Warsaw, Poland
What to Expect
- Lectures and live presentations
- Masterclass workshops
- Portfolio reviews
- Photo walks
- Photography exhibitions
- Touch & Try hands-on gear testing
- Free camera and lens loans
- Free service support, including firmware updates and sensor cleaning
